Busan I’Park, 3-1 come-from-behind victory over Seongnam… Victory in 4 matches

Busan IPark, a professional soccer team, overcame Seongnam FC and tasted victory in 4 games.

Busan won a pleasant 3-1 come-from-behind victory in the Hana One Q K League 2 2023 away game held at Tancheon Sports Complex on the 22nd. Peshin took the lead in winning with one goal and one assist.

Busan, which had no wins in the last 3 matches with 2 draws and 1 loss, took a victory and 3 points in 4 matches. With 15 points (4 wins, 3 draws and 1 loss), Busan moved up one notch to 4th in the league.

On this day, Busan gave up the opening goal early in the first half. In the 6th minute of the first half, Seongnam Kim Jin-rae’s cross, which broke through the left side, was rushed to the goal by Sim Dong-woon, who shook the Busan net by kicking it.

Falling behind 0-1, Busan continued to be pushed back by Seongnam’s offensive and did not have a chance to say anything like this. In the 29th minute of the first half, manager Park Jin-seop replaced Ji-mook Choi and Sang-jun Kim and put in Min-hyeok Lim and Jeong-won Eo to reorganize the defense line.

In the 34th minute of the first half, Busan counterattacked. Eo Jeong-won’s throw-in into the penalty area was cleared by the opposing defense, and it went to Peshin, and Choi Geon-joo finished the ball with a non-stop shot, scoring the equalizer.

As the score was tied 1-1, Busan’s offense came to life. Busan managed to turn around in the 6th minute of the second half. Lamas passed the ball, and Pesin placed it in the corner of the goal with a left-footed shot with an opposing defender in front.

Busan, which turned 2-1, withstood Seongnam’s wave of offensive attacks. In the 25th minute of the second half, Kim Jin-rae’s cross hit Jo Wi-je’s leg and went slightly over the goalpost, escaping the risk of an own goal.

With 10 minutes left in the second half, Busan’s last-minute offensive unfolded. In the 35th minute of the second half, Choi Ki-yoon, who replaced Choi Geon-ju, cut back the ball from the left side of the penalty area, and Lamars fired a left-footed shot, but it went high. In the 43rd minute of the second half, a shot by Kim Chan, who had been replaced by Peshin, was blocked by the goalkeeper. In the 45th minute of the second half, Choi Ki-yoon, who received Lamas’ penetrating pass, faced the goalkeeper one-on-one, but the shot was blocked by the goalkeeper.

Busan, which kept knocking, opened the Seongnam goal again in the second half of the extra time. Goalkeeper Koo Sang-min kicked the long ball straight to Chan Kim in the front line, and Chan Kim scored the key goal with a left-footed shot. In the end, Busan defeated Seongnam with a 3-1, 2-goal margin.
